How to Update a Room Without Spending

Recently I posted about how I've lightened my décor throughout the house, all except the guest room.  That had to be changed, and I figured out a way to do it without spending a dime. BEFORE: Fine for the Autumn/Winter months, but a little too dark for the Spring and Summer. Here's what I did. First I swapped out the dark brown curtains for these breezy, lacy toppers that I've had for a long time. To lighten the comforter, I simply reversed (flipped over) it to the solid taupe side. The winter side has swede inserts which the back doesn't have, so this works out great for the warmer months. Just pretend you don't see my reflection in my PJ's in the mirror!  :)
